Ir para conteúdo
Fórum Script Brasil
  • 0

Help ... Insert


Rampage

Pergunta

seguinte... estou fazendo um sistema de clans..

e na hora de criacao de um clan ... ou seja insert na database...

ele retorna pra mim "seu clan foi registrado com sucesso !"

porem quando vou ver o BD não houve inserção alguma na tabela..

o código acessa a database... verifica se já existe algum clan com a mesma sigla...

e se existe retorna corretamente a informaçao de q o clan já existe ... porem o maldito não insere um novo clan na tabela do mysql de geito nenhum...

alguém pode me dizer aonde estou errando ??

                 <?

        include("config.php");
        $connection = mysql_connect("$server", "$db_user", "$db_pass");
        $db = mysql_select_db("$database", $connection);
        $query = "SELECT * FROM clans where sigla='$sigla'";
        $result = mysql_query($query, $connection);

        $exsigla=mysql_numrows($result);

?>
                  <?

if($nome=='' OR $sigla=='' OR $www=='' OR $admin=='')
{
 echo "Preencha todos os campos!";
}
elseif($exsigla=='1')
{
echo "Este clan já existe !";
}
else
{
include("config.php");
$connection = mysql_connect("$server", "$db_user", "$db_pass");
$db = mysql_select_db("$database", $connection);
$sql = "INSERT INTO clans (`nome`,`sigla`,`www`,`admin`)".
  "VALUES ('$nome', '$sigla', '$www','$admin')";
$result = mysql_query($sql, $connection);

echo "Seu clan foi registrado com sucesso !";
}
?>

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0

Bom, aqui tem um erro:

$exsigla=mysql_numrows($result);
O certo é:
$exsigla=mysql_num_rows($result);
não sei porque não insere, tenta por:
or die(mysql_error());
No final das querys de MySQL para ver qual o erro. Depois poste aqui. E poe esse query aqui para inserir:
$sql = "INSERT INTO clans (`nome`,`sigla`,`www`,`admin`) VALUES ('$nome', '$sigla', '$www','$admin')";

E qual é esse config.php?

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,8k
×
×
  • Criar Novo...